Metabolic Echoes: Paternal Signals Shaping Early Embryonic Life
Abstract
For a long time, the paternal contribution to early development was
reduced to DNA alone. Today, a different picture is emerging—one in
which fathers transmit a rich constellation of signals that extend far
beyond genetics. Sperm cells carry epigenetic marks shaped by diet,
metabolism, and environmental exposures, and these marks accompany the
embryo from the very first moments, influencing how it interprets and
responds to its surroundings. At the same time, sperm also delivers a
metabolic cargo: polar metabolites, hormones, lipids and other bioactive
molecules that persist after fertilization and integrate into the
embryo’s early metabolic circuits.
Together, these informational and metabolic layers form a paternal
imprint that resonates through the earliest stages of development,
subtly guiding growth, hormonal balance, and long‑term metabolic
trajectories. This expanded view reveals a continuous dialogue between
paternal physiology and embryonic fate—one that begins well before
conception and may echo across generations.
Biography
Mariano Stornaiuolo is Associate Professor of Applied Biology at the
Department of Pharmacy, University of Naples Federico II. He holds a
Master’s degree in Chemistry (2001) and a PhD in Genetics and
Molecular Medicine (2006), both from the University of Naples Federico
II. After completing his doctoral work on protein misfolding and
intracellular trafficking, he carried out postdoctoral research in the
Netherlands, first at Utrecht University (2006) and later at the
Netherlands Cancer Institute (2009), where he investigated mitochondrial
metabolism and the structural biology of ligand‑gated ion channels.
He returned to Italy in 2013, expanding his research into cell
metabolism and how it influences cell decisions, fate, disease, and
transformation. Since 2016 he has been part of the Department of
Pharmacy at Federico II, first as Researcher and, from 2019, as
Associate Professor. His work now focuses on paternal epigenetic
inheritance, sperm biology, and the metabolic determinants of early
embryonic development.
In addition to his research and teaching activities, since 2018 he
serves as the Rector’s Delegate for Academic Studies in Prison in
Nisida, Secondigliano and Poggioreale Penitentiary Education Programs,
promoting higher education and scientific training in correctional
institutions.
